Specifications
Number of Inputs: | 2 |
Features: | -- |
Voltage - Supply: | 1.65 V ~ 5.5 V |
Current - Quiescent (Max): | 1µA |
Current - Output High, Low: | 32mA, 32mA |
Logic Level - Low: | -- |
Logic Level - High: | -- |
Max Propagation Delay @ V, Max CL: | 3.7ns @ 5V, 50pF |
Operating Temperature: | -40°C ~ 85°C |
Mounting Type: | Surface Mount |
Supplier Device Package: | US8 |
Package / Case: | 8-VFSOP (0.091", 2.30mm Width) |
Base Part Number: | 7WZ32 |
Series: | 7WZ |
Packaging: | Tape & Reel (TR) |
Part Status: | Active |
Logic Type: | OR Gate |
Number of Circuits: | 2 |
